Transportation Referendum Panel Discussion
Glenn Memorial United Methodist Church, 1660 N Decatur Rd NE, Atlanta, GA | Get Directions »
FREE
The Metro Atlanta region will vote July 31 on a regional transportation 1% sales tax. This panel, featuring government and transportation leaders, will discuss the impact and provide an audience Q&A opportunity.
Welcoming remarks will by given by Mike Mandl, Executive Vice President, Finance & Administration, Emory University. The panel discussion will be moderated by Sally Sears, television news reporter and the panelists will be:
- Burrell Ellis, DeKalb County CEO
- Bill Floyd, Mayor, City of Decatur
- Beverly Scott, CEO & GM, MARTA
- Mike Alexander, Chief, Atlanta Regional Commission, Division of Research

More About Glenn Memorial United Methodist Church
The Glenn Memorial United Methodist Church was built in 1920 and is located at the entrance of Emory University's main campus. Glenn Memorial offers several religious services for the Emory community. Additionally, it functions as the largest auditorium on Emory's campus and hosts several conferences, workshops and performance events throughout the school year.
